-
ClickHouse连接失败主因是协议与端口不匹配:默认clickhouse-go走HTTP(8123),但生产环境常仅开放TCP(9000);应改用tcp://DSN、确认服务端tcp_port启用,或显式设secure=false;空结果多因未检查rows.Err()及字段顺序/类型不匹配;批量插入须用PrepareBatch而非单条执行;GROUPBY需显式AS别名并按序Scan;务必核对驱动与服务端版本兼容性。
-
图片溢出多列容器的主因是原始尺寸超列宽且未自动缩放,解决关键是设max-width:100%并配合height:auto保持比例;再用object-fit(如cover或contain)控制显示效果,同时确保父容器支持流式布局且无干扰属性。
-
收到“格式错误”提示时,应依次尝试:一、用Excel“打开并修复”功能;二、验证并修正文件扩展名;三、解压XLSX为ZIP检查内部XML;四、调用自动恢复文件(.asd)回溯未保存内容。
-
使用Collections.synchronizedXxx方法可将普通集合包装为线程安全,但遍历时需手动加锁;2.java.util.concurrent包提供高性能并发集合如ConcurrentHashMap、CopyOnWriteArrayList等,内部已同步,适用于高并发场景;3.可通过synchronized关键字或ReentrantLock手动同步自定义集合操作,灵活性高但需确保锁覆盖所有访问路径;4.选择方案应根据场景:高并发优先用并发包集合,简单需求可用同步包装,且不可忽略遍历同步集合时的
-
选择安装方法需权衡版本需求与便捷性,Ubuntu等系统可用apt安装或官网二进制包;若版本过低,可添加PPA、使用snap或手动安装;GOROOT为安装路径,GOPATH为工作区,Module启用后项目可脱离GOPATH,通过gomodinit初始化,依赖自动管理,配置PATH包含$GOPATH/bin和$GOROOT/bin即可正常使用。
-
QQ短链接还原并非解密,而是通过HTTP302重定向跟踪获取Location头中的真实URL;需用cURL配置FOLLOWLOCATION、MAXREDIRS等选项并捕获EFFECTIVE_URL,注意Referer校验、JS跳转、Cookie依赖及风控拦截。
-
双通道抢票功能需手动开启并配置,同步启用12306候补与智行余票监控,二者独立运行、互为备份;通过状态栏显示、多提示推送及订单来源标注可验证其正常运行。
-
首先检查路由定义顺序是否精确路由优先,再确认请求方法与路由绑定一致,接着排查路由分组前缀和中间件拦截问题,然后通过调试输出验证路由注册情况,最后确保Web服务器重写规则正确并将请求指向入口文件。
-
透明度和渐变通过opacity、rgba及linear-gradient等CSS属性提升网页视觉层次,opacity控制整体透明,rgba实现背景透明不影响文字,linear-gradient和radial-gradient创建色彩过渡效果,合理搭配可增强界面现代感与空间感。
-
Go测试函数必须命名为Test且参数为testing.T,需置于*_test.go文件中、同包内,子测试名禁用斜杠和空格,测试文件应保持纯净以避免意外依赖。
-
响应式图片技术通过srcset和sizes属性让浏览器根据设备屏幕特性自动选择最适配图片;配合picture元素可按设备类型与分辨率双重适配;推荐按宽度命名并用构建工具自动生成多尺寸版本。
-
DFS拓扑排序结果逆序是因递归退出时记录节点,此时所有后继已处理完,天然满足前置依赖优先;需reverse得正序,或改用BFS法避免栈溢出。
-
ArgoCD的Application资源需显式定义在Git仓库中(如apps/my-service.yaml),由AppProject授权部署,spec.source.repoURL必须是集群可访问地址,spec.destination.namespace不可省略,默认default常导致同步失败。
-
用is_iterable()是最直接的判断方式PHP7.1+原生提供了is_iterable()函数,它能准确识别数组、Traversable对象(如Iterator、Generator、ArrayObject等),返回布尔值。这是唯一推荐的「语义正确」方式。常见错误是用is_array()或instanceofTraversable单独判断——前者漏掉对象,后者漏掉数组,两者合用又啰嗦且易出错。is_iterable([])→trueis_iterable(ne
-
首先使用12306在线选铺功能,在支持选铺的车次中直接选择下铺;若乘车人年满60岁,系统将自动优先分配下铺;也可通过线下窗口购票时人工申请下铺。